Output 23c376400e9419b30172f03f8c215b6e758ebcd4e4fd34a67806199ed336083b:0

value
2595000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1873d5a379be786482f3d70b71329f635441dccf OP_EQUAL
address
MA8TDMimNgqamEKYXWzGy6KfEVtdKE8R6K
transaction
23c376400e9419b30172f03f8c215b6e758ebcd4e4fd34a67806199ed336083b
spent
true